Allowing the engine to idle uses fuel inefficiently and can cause a build-up of carbon in the engine.

If machine must be left with the engine running for more than 3 or 4 minutes, minimum engine speed should be 1000 rpm.

View the engine rpm’s (A) on Sprayer Main Page if that feature has been selected on one of the dropdown menus available on that page. Push forward on throttle lever (B) until desired RPM is displayed.
